Foxboro FBM223 P0917HD Digital I/O Module – Reliable 24 VDC Discrete Signal Interface for I/A Series Systems

foxboro_fbm223_p0917hd_digital_i_o_module_3foxboro_fbm223_p0917hd_digital_i_o_module_2

The Foxboro FBM223 P0917HD is a field-proven digital I/O module for the I/A Series (Schneider Electric/Invensys) control platform, typically applied as a 24 VDC discrete input interface with dense channel capacity. From my experience, it’s chosen when plants need stable, noise-immune monitoring of limit switches, pushbuttons, proximity sensors, valve feedback, and general machine status—without complicating the cabinet. You might notice that it fits the standard FBM footprint, supports hot-swap on the baseplate, and plays nicely with redundant system architectures.

Key Features

  • 24 VDC discrete signal handling – Commonly used as a 16‑channel digital input module for proximity switches, dry contacts, and panel devices.
  • Hot-swappable FBM form factor – Swap the module on a powered baseplate to minimize downtime during maintenance.
  • Robust electrical isolation – Channel-group to bus isolation helps protect the controller from field disturbances; typically designed for industrial noise environments.
  • Built-in status diagnostics – Front LEDs and per-channel health reporting make fault tracing faster on site.
  • Backplane communications – Interfaces to the I/A Series via the module fieldbus on the baseplate; no extra external comm ports to wire.
  • Redundancy compatible – Works in redundant system layouts when used with appropriate baseplates and controllers, helping meet high-availability targets.
  • Clean cabinet integration – DIN-rail baseplate mounting with removable terminal assemblies keeps wiring tidy and serviceable.

Installation & Maintenance

  • Cabinet & environment – Install on the approved Foxboro DIN-rail baseplate inside a clean, ventilated control cabinet. Keep ambient within 0–50 °C and avoid vibration where possible.
  • Wiring practices – Use the matching terminal assembly; segregate discrete I/O from high-voltage lines; common the returns as per the chosen sourcing/sinking scheme. Label channels for faster troubleshooting.
  • Grounding & noise – Maintain a solid cabinet ground; route sensor cabling away from VFD outputs. Add ferrites or shielded cable for long runs if noise is present.
  • Hot-swap procedure – Place controller in a safe state as your procedures require, then release the FBM locking tabs and swap. Verify LEDs and channel states after insertion.
  • Routine care – Periodically check terminal tightness, clean vents lightly (dry air), and review diagnostics. Firmware updates are handled at the system level when applicable.
